On Tue, Nov 28, 2017 at 4:32 PM, Michael Niedermayer <mich...@niedermayer.cc > wrote: > > > This breaks converting of this: > ./ffmpeg -i bgc.sub.dub.ogm -vf subtitles=bgc.sub.dub.ogm -an file.avi > > https://samples.ffmpeg.org/ogg/bgc.sub.dub.ogm > > That's due to the vorbis parser returning AVERROR_INVALIDDATA here, with pkt_type == 5 and priv->packet[0] == priv_packet[1] == null. http://git.videolan.org/?p=ffmpeg.git;a=blob;f=libavformat/oggparsevorbis.c;h=65b1998a02d92d0fcaeb740d8f4523641502dbea;hb=HEAD#l319
Which were added in 2010 here: http://git.videolan.org/?p=ffmpeg.git;a=commitdiff;h=73c44cb2869bfdbea829942eb35efa6d4c4e2f91 It seems that file has invalid vorbis streams if the check is to be believed. What do you want to do here?
